NATO and Warsaw Pact
Formation of NATO
NATO was a reaction to the Berlin Blockade
Headquarters in Brussels
Attack by Russia was seen as an attack on the entire organization. This organization was a way of the Democractic countries to counter the Soviet union.
First combat was not seen until 1994.
Soviet response: Warsaw Pact
“a Treaty of friendship, co-operation, and mutual assistance”
A reaction to militarized west Germany joining NATO.
